Removing A/C Compressor, can I drive w/o it?
I know the compressor has it's own belt so that's in my favor. I'm not for sure what is going out but I need to replace something on it. Can I take my A/C compressor off my car, and be able to drive (to Tx) w/o it??? Will it throw a code or SES light??? Will anything else go wrong or will I be safe??? Re: Removing A/C Compressor, can I drive w/o it?
Why not remove the belt, but leave the compressor on in the meantime (prior to service)? If you take it off, you'll run the risk of contaminating things between now and when you get a new compressor.
